Job Description

We are looking for a detail-oriented Data Entry Clerk to support a contract assignment. In this permanent, in-person role, you will help organize and classify commercial insurance records by applying a labeling framework across multiple business data sources. This contract position is expected to last 2 months with potential for extension, and it is ideal for someone who works carefully, follows guidelines consistently, and communicates clearly when information needs review.
Responsibilities:
  • Review commercial insurance records and enter structured information into spreadsheets with a high level of accuracy.
  • Compare details across internal platforms and supporting files to classify accounts, quote activity, and deal outcomes correctly.
  • Apply standardized labeling rules to identify business type, coverage details, quoting route, pricing information, and policy status.
  • Document unclear or incomplete records with concise notes and escalate them for review rather than making assumptions.
  • Track supporting documentation such as prior coverage records, payroll information, identification files, and related materials tied to each account.
  • Maintain steady daily output while preserving consistency and data quality across a high volume of records.
  • Adapt quickly to updates in the annotation guide and implement revised instructions throughout the project.
